Webalarms (i.e. not PP3 type or user-replaceable) are also permitted – the expiry date should be visible on each alarm. 8. Smoke alarms should conform to BS EN 14604. Heat alarms should conform to BS 5446-2. Multi-sensor alarms. should conform to BS EN 54-29 or BS EN 14604. For more detailed information on smoke alarms, see BS 5839 Part 6. 9. WebSmoke alarms need to meet the BS EN14604:2005 standard. The heat alarm needs to meet the BS 5446-2:2003 standard. Carbon monoxide alarms should have the British Kitemark (EN 50291-1). What will this cost? We have seen sets comprising two heat alarms and a smoke alarm that meet the Scottish Standard for £107, including VAT and delivery. WebSmoke Alarms are required in every circulation area such as hallways and landings; day-time frequented areas such as living room; converted attic if applicable. It is also …

All rented and privately owned homes must have: one smoke alarm in the living room or room you use most one smoke alarm in every hallway or landing. one heat alarm in the kitchen Each alarm should be installed on the ceiling and interlinked.
